AIR CONDITIONING SYSTEM
PRECAUTION
1. DO NOT HANDLE REFRIGERANT IN AN ENCLOSED
AREA OR WEAR EYE PROTECTION
2. ALWAYS WEAR EYE PROTECTION
3. BE CAREFUL NOT TO GET LIQUID REFRIGERANT IN
YOUR EYES OR ON YOUR SKIN
If liquid refrigerant gets in your eyes or on your skin.
(a) Wash the area with lots of cool water.
CAUTION:
Do not rub your eyes or skin.
(b) Apply clean petroleum jelly to the skin.
(c) Go immediately to a physician or hospital for professional
treatment.
4. NEVER HEAT CONTAINER OR EXPOSE IT TO NAKED
FLAME
5. BE CAREFUL NOT TO DROP CONTAINER AND NOT
TO APPLY PHYSICAL SHOCKS TO IT
6. DO NOT OPERATE COMPRESSOR WITHOUT
ENOUGH REFRIGERANT IN REFRIGERATION SYS-
TEM
If there is not enough refrigerant in the refrigerant system oil lu-
brication will be insufficient and compressor burnout may occur,
so that care to avoid this, necessary care should be taken.
7. DO NOT OPEN PRESSURE MANIFOLD VALVE WHILE
COMPRESSOR IS OPERATE
If the high pressure valve is opened, refrigerant flows in the re-
verse direction and could cause the charging cylinder to rup-
ture, so open and close the only low pressure valve.
8. BE CAREFUL NOT TO OVERCHARGE SYSTEM WITH
REFRIGERANT
If refrigerant is overcharged, it causes problems such as insuffi-
cient cooling, poor fuel economy, engine overheating etc.

(6) Refrigerant overcharged or insufficient cooling of
condenser
Symptom seen in
refrigeration systemProbable causeDiagnosisRemedy
Pressure too high on both low
and high pressure sides
No air bubbles seen through the
sight glass even when the engine
rpm is lowered Unable to develop sufficient per-
formance due to excessive refrig-
eration system
Insufficient cooling of condenser Excessive refrigerant in
cycle " refrigerant over charged
Condenser cooling " condenser
fins clogged of condenser fan
faulty
(1) Clean condenser
(2) Check condenser fan motor
operation
(3) If (1) and (2) are in normal
state, check amount of refrigerant
Charge proper amount of refriger-
ant
(7) Air present in refrigeration system
Symptom seen in
refrigeration systemProbable causeDiagnosisRemedy
Pressure too high on both low
and high pressure sides
The low pressure piping hot to
touch
Bubbles seen in sight glass
Air entered in refrigeration system
Air present in refrigeration sys-
tem
Insufficient vacuum purging
(1) Check compressor oil to see if
it is dirty or insufficient
(2) Evacuate air and charge new
refrigerant

(1) Inert SST to piping clamp.
HINT:
Confirm the direction of the piping clamp claw and SST using
the illustration showing on the caution label.
(2) Push down SST and release the clamp lock.
NOTICE:
Be careful not to deform the tubes, when pushing SST.
(3) Pull SST slightly and push the release lever, then re-
move the piping clamp with SST.
(4) Remove the piping clamp from SST.
(b) Disconnect the both tubes.
NOTICE:
Do not use tools like screwdriver to remove the tube.
Cap the open fittings immediately to keep moisture or
dirt out of the system.
HINT:
At the time of installation, please refer to the following item.
Lubricate 4 new O±rings with compressor oil and install
the tubes.
After connection, check the fitting for claw of the piping
clamp.
7. REMOVE A/C UNIT
(a) Disconnect the connector.
(b) Slide the floor carpet backward.
(c) Remove the rear heater duct.
(d) Remove the 2 nuts and A/C unit.

REASSEMBLY
1. INSTALL THERMISTOR TO EVAPORATOR
2. INSTALL EVAPORATOR
(a) Install the plate to the evaporator.
(b) Install the evaporator on the insulator.
(c) Connect the heater case with the 13 screws.
NOTICE:
The packing for water seal should be replaced, with a new
one when the A/C unit is reassembled.
(d) Install the 2 new packings.
(e) Install the grommet to evaporator.
HINT:
If evaporator is replaced, add compressor oil to the compressor.
Add 40 ± 50 cc (1.4 ± 1.7 fl.oz.)
Compressor oil: ND ± OIL 8 or equivalent
3. INSTALL EXPANSION VALVE
(a) Lubricate 2 new O±rings with compressor oil and install
the tubes.
(b) Install the liquid tube and suction tube on the expansion
valve.
(c) Using a knife, cut off packing paper of packing while peel
off the paper, as shown in the illustration.
HINT:
Leave the packing paper untaped on the tube side so that the
installation bolt hole for remains visible.
(d) Apply new packing.
NOTICE:
Do not overtape the packing beyond the expansion valve
edge.
Page 32 of 4592
N20283
N20245
Pin
Pin AC±32
± AIR CONDITIONINGAIR CONDITIONING UNIT
2514 Author: Date:
(e) Lubricate 2 new O±rings with compressor oil and install
the expansion valve.
(f) Install the expansion valve with the tubes to evaporator
with the 2 bolts.
Torque: 5.4 N´m (55 kgf´cm, 48 in.´lbf)
NOTICE:
When installing the expansion valve, take care so that the
packing is not jammed with the evaporator.
(g) Peel off the remaining packing paper and apply the pack-
ing to expansion valve.
4. INSTALL HEATER RADIATOR
(a) Install the heater radiator to heater case.
(b) Install the heater radiator pipe with 2 clips.
(c) Install the 3 clamps with the 3 screws.
5. INSTALL MODE SERVOMOTOR
(a) Install the servomotor with the 3 screws.
(b) Insert the drain of the plate to the pin and install plate.

COMPRESSOR AND MAGNETIC
CLUTCH
ON±VEHICLE INSPECTION
1. INSPECT COMPRESSOR FOR METALLIC SOUND
(a) Start engine.
(b) Check if there is a metallic sound from the compressor
when the A/C switch is on.
If metallic sound is heard, replace the compressor assembly.
2. INSPECT REFRIGERANT PRESSURE
See ºON±VEHICLE INSPECTIONº of AIR CONDITIONING
SYSTEM on page AC±3.
3. INSPECT COMPRESSOR LOCK SENSOR RESIS-
TANCE
(a) Disconnect the connector.
(b) Measure resistance between terminals 1 and 2.
Standard resistance: 65 ± 125 W at 20 °C (68 °F)
If resistance is not as specified, replace the compressor assem-
bly.
4. INSPECT VISUALLY FOR LEAKAGE OF REFRIGER-
ANT FROM SAFETY SEAL
Using a gas leak detector, check for leakage of refrigerant.
If there is any leakage, replace the compressor assembly.
5. CHECK FOR LEAKAGE OF GREASE FROM CLUTCH
BEARING
6. CHECK FOR SIGNS OF OIL ON PRESSURE PLATE OR
ROTOR
7. INSPECT MAGNETIC CLUTCH BEARING FOR NOISE
(a) Start engine.
(b) Check for abnormal noise from near the compressor
when the A/C switch is OFF.
If abnormal noise is being emitted, replace the magnetic clutch.
8. INSPECT MAGNETIC CLUTCH OPERATION
(a) Disconnect the connector.
(b) Connect the positive (+) lead from the battery to terminal
4 and the negative (±) lead to the body ground.
(c) Check that the magnetic clutch is energized.
If operation is not as specified, replace the magnetic clutch.

INSTALLATION
1. 5S±FE engine models:
INSTALL COMPRESSOR
(a) Install the compressor with 3 bolts.
Torque: 25 N´m (250 kgf´cm, 18 ft´lbf)
(b) Connect the connector.
2. 1MZ±FE engine models:
INSTALL COMPRESSOR
(a) Install the compressor with 3 bolts.
Torque: 25 N´m (250 kgf´cm, 18 ft´lbf)
(b) Install the drive belt adjusting bar bracket with 2 bolts and
nut.
Torque:
Bolt (A): 25 N´m (250 kgf´cm, 18 ft´lbf)
Bolt (B): 18 N´m (185 kgf´cm, 13 ft´lbf)
Nut: 25 N´m (250 kgf´cm, 18 ft´lbf)
(c) Connect the connector.
3. 5S±FE engine models:
CONNECT DISCHARGE AND SUCTION HOSE
Connect the both hoses with the 2 bolts.
Torque: 10 N´m (100 kgf´cm, 7 ft´lbf)
NOTICE:
Hoses should be connected immediately after the caps
have been removed.
HINT:
Lubricate 2 new O±rings with compressor oil and install the
tubes.
4. 1MZ±FE engine models:
INSTALL GENERATOR
(a) Mount generator on the generator bracket with the pivot
bolt and adjusting lock bolt. Do not tighten the bolts yet.
(b) Connect the generator connector.
(c) Connect the generator wire with the nut.
